Suzanne Wisdom Named to National CASA Association Marketing & Communications Committee

Suzanne Wisdom has been appointed to serve National Court Appointed Special Advocates Association as a member of the newly formed marketing and communications network committee.

Network committees will advise and provide support to National CASA Association in its work on behalf of state organizations and local programs, by sharing expertise and providing input and guidance. The newly formed committees will focus their efforts in cultivating growth in four key functional areas of the organization: legal/advocacy, marketing/communications, performance measurement, and the organization’s annual national conference.
 
“Through strong partnerships and collaborative strategies, together we will strengthen the foundation of the CASA/GAL member network, create pathways for sustainable organizational growth, and generate better outcomes for the abused and neglected children served in the communities we serve,” said Tara Perry, Chief Executive Officer of National CASA Association.
 
Suzanne Wisdom, MPA, Executive Director, with Savannah/Chatham CASA in Savannah, GA, was appointed to the National CASA Association Marketing and Communications Committee.  Along with 11 other CASA colleagues from across the county, Suzanne will be sharing her expertise in marketing and communications.  She served as a founding Executive Director of CASA of Bradley County in Cleveland, TN from 2007 until 2015 when she accepted the position of Executive Director of Savannah/Chatham CASA.   Her history of starting a CASA program from the ground up as well as serving in different types of communities gives her a unique perspective on the communications and marketing needs of a CASA organization.
 
“I am excited and honored to be appointed to this committee.  It feels great being able to take the things I’ve learned as a CASA director over the years and give input that may help other CASA agencies nationwide,” said Suzanne Wisdom, Savannah/Chatham CASA Executive Director.
 
“This engagement with state and local members is rooted in the National CASA Association Strategic Framework,” said Perry. “We are very appreciative and excited to have this level of talent serving on these committees.”
